Reliance Industries' Jio Platforms clearing a major hurdle in its joint venture with Luxembourg-based SES to provide gigabit fibre internet. This comes as companies like Amazon.com and Elon Musk's Starlink wait for the go-ahead to launch satellite communication services in Indi. The Indian National Space Promotion and Authorisation Centre (IN-SPACe) has granted authorisations to Orbit Connect India, allowing it to operate satellites above India. Satellite broadband service market in India is expected to grow 36% per year over the next five years and reach $1.9 billion by 2030 Furthermore Ambani's diverse portfolio and Huge distribution chain will make it Well Crafted Weapon just like Early days of Jio!
